Derivación a motor inteligente, 690V AC, tam. S00

Inteligente derivación a motor arrancador directo High Feature 0,4-4 A hasta 690 V AC tipo de coordinación 2, tamaño S00 para sistema Et 200sp, consta de 3RC7140-1EE10, 3RV2311-1EC20, 3RT2017-2BB42
